The Patek 5168

The Patek 5168 is one of the most talked-about releases in the Patek Philippe Aquanaut line. As the largest model in the Aquanaut collection, it measures 42.2mm in diameter and is crafted from 18k white gold. Known as a natural evolution of the original Aquanaut ref, the 5168 offers a distinctly sporty look paired with classic Patek Philippe craftsmanship.

First introduced with a night blue dial and later released in the standout khaki green color, this timepiece captures a bold, assertive utilitarian aesthetic while maintaining elegance. The 5168G, sometimes referred to as ref 5168G 010, quickly became the main attraction of the modern Aquanaut series—garnering a long waitlist and status as one of the most sought-after Patek models in recent years.

Key Characteristics of the Patek 5168

White Gold Case

The white gold case offers a sleek contrast against the textured dial and matching tropical rubber strap, with a 42.2mm diameter that gives it strong wrist presence.

Embossed Dial with Bold Numerals

Whether in khaki green or night blue, the dial features embossed detailing with large Arabic numerals, keeping the design both sporty and legible.

Tropical Rubber Strap

The rubber strap is made from a durable, comfortable composite material that resists wear, water, and heat. Its same color design complements the dial for a seamless look.

Screw-Down Crown

Provides water resistance up to 120 meters and contributes to the assertive and durable design of the watch.

Octagonal Bezel

A signature trait of the Aquanaut line, the rounded octagonal bezel is a nod to its Nautilus sibling and adds to its unique silhouette.

Self Winding Movement

The automatic winding movement, Caliber 324 S C, includes a central winding rotor in 21k gold and offers a power reserve of up to 45 hours.

Hand Finishing and the Patek Philippe Seal

Each movement is completed with traditional hand finishing and carries the Patek Philippe Seal, a sign of strict standards in quality, precision, and durability.

Spiromax Balance Spring and Second Wheel

With a Spiromax balance spring, second wheel, and advanced balance technology, the 5168 is engineered for accurate performance under daily wear.

Frequently Asked Questions for the Patek 5168

The watch features an 18k white gold case and a durable rubber strap designed for daily wear and comfort.

The Patek 5168 is powered by an automatic winding movement—specifically, the Caliber 324 S C with a central winding rotor and a power reserve of 35–45 hours.

The khaki green version offers a bolder, military-inspired style, while the night blue version presents a darker shade with a slightly more classic appeal. Both come with a same color strap and dial.

The Patek Philippe 5168 is called the jumbo because it has a 42.2mm diameter, making it the largest in the Aquanaut line. This size represents a natural evolution from the early days of smaller Aquanaut ref models and gives it a more modern and assertive wrist presence.

The Patek Philippe Seal is a mark of excellence applied to movements that meet the brand’s highest standards for accuracy, hand finishing, and long-term reliability—beyond even COSC certification.
